Before enabling the stricter Lintharrow ruleset on the Pellgrove monorepo, you must regenerate the baseline file so existing violations are suppressed rather than failing the build. Delete the old baseline first; regenerating over a stale one silently merges entries and hides regressions. Run the baseline task from the repo root, commit the resulting file, and confirm CI passes before proceeding to step 5. The analyzer reads its service settings at startup, and the values currently in effect are listed below.

deployment values, yahag-tawef:
ZORWYN_HOST=zorwyn.tolvaqlabs.internal
ZORWYN_PORT=9300

Test Plan — Castwren Feed Validator, v1.3

Scope: validate RSS and Atom podcast feeds for enclosure integrity, episode GUID uniqueness, and artwork dimensions. New team members: start with the golden-feed suite before touching fuzz cases. Each run pulls fixture feeds from the Marrowlight staging bucket; failures write diffs to the run artifact folder. Do not test against production feeds — publishers get notified of fetch spikes. The staging fetcher requires authentication, so export the bearer token listed below before running the suite.

bearer token for tawep-kagef: eyJhbGciOiJIUzI1NiIsInR5cCI6IkpXVCJ9.eyJzdWIiOiIFqiOjJIn0.x-s-X_9p

Subject: Schema registry now gating event publishes

Team — as of today, all events on the Fenwick bus must have a schema registered in Corvid before publish. Unregistered payloads get rejected at the broker, no exceptions. New joiners: register schemas via the Corvid CLI, not the web form; the form lags replication by hours. Compatibility mode is BACKWARD for all topics. Questions go to the #corvid-help channel. The registry build token for this rollout is below.

pipeline stamp: htk6_35e0c9